This runbook covers the Farepoint pricing experiment running on the Tillbrook event platform. The experiment service splits traffic 70/30 and logs variant assignments to the Ledgerline store. If assignment rates drift more than 5% from the configured split, pause the experiment via the admin console and notify the pricing channel. To pull assignment metrics or pause variants through the Farepoint control API, authenticate with the key below.

gateway credential: kto23_LX9A4ys6i4nzHtpOLNLodKK

## Runbook: Blue-green deploy — billing worker (Orvane Pay)

New folks: the billing worker runs as two identical stacks, cobalt and jade. Only one processes the charge queue at a time. Deploys go to the idle stack, smoke tests run against sandbox invoices, then traffic flips via the Latchboard toggle. If charge error rates rise within ten minutes, flip back — no redeploy needed. Both stacks write to the same ledger database, so migrations ship separately and first. That shared ledger is reachable at the connection string below.

primary connection of bajof-tagag = mssql://holius_svc:c6R4gB6k1PKY3Y@db-79d4.kelvitech.internal:5432/jorix

Ticket — Flagpole vault locked (blocking review)

Hey, quick heads-up before you review my rollout-framework branch: the Flagpole secrets vault locked itself again after the CI runner hammered it with stale tokens. That means the integration tests for staged rollouts (percentage ramps, kill switches) can't fetch the signing key and will show red — not my code, promise. Everything else in the diff should be reviewable as-is. To unlock the vault locally and re-run the suite, use the recovery passphrase:

unlock words, fafop-hawep: briwyn-oliix-sorox